fix(index.js) The tabIndex of audio, video and details was left to th…
…e default if set to some NaN (#610) * fix(index.js) The tabIndex of contentEditable elements was assumed to be zero in any case, not only in the case it was not specifically set. * Simplified and optimized 'getTabIndex'. * Made better use of short-circuit evaluation in 'isNodeMatchingSelectorTabbable', reducing the chances to call the computationally expensive 'isNodeMatchingSelectorFocusable'. * (Re)Added 'isScope' parameter to 'getTabIndex'. This parameter wasn't present in the master branch, so I lost it in the rebase process. * Added tests for a `contenteditable` with negative tab index. * Fixed bug, now the getTabIndex can return 0 not only when the tabindex is not explicitly set, but also when is set to a value that gives NaN when parsed as integer (which would have been resulted in the default browser tabIndex, as if the tabindex wasn't set at all). Also added test for the case an element has a tab index that can't be turned into an integer. * Added changeset, added entry in CHANGELOG.md and wrote more tests. * Be consistent with asterisks * Sync package.json/yarn.lock with beta-530 base branch Co-authored-by: Stefan Cameron <[email protected]>

Fixed a bug in `getTabIndex`: the tab index of `<audio>`, `<viedo>` and `<details>` was left to the browser default if explicitly set to a value that couldn't be parsed as integer, leading to inconsistent behaviour across browsers. Also slightly modified the function's logic to make it more efficient. Finally added tests to cover the fix. |
